As a Data Center Technician, you will play a vital role in supporting Oracle’s cloud infrastructure. You will be responsible for hardware installation, troubleshooting, structured cabling, and maintaining the operational health of our data centers. This hands‑on role requires a proactive, process‑oriented technician with strong attention to detail and a commitment to operational excellence.

This position involves working on a 24/7 shift rotation.

Skills & Qualifications
  • Experience:
    • 2+ years of hands‑on experience in data center operations, ideally in high‑performance computing (HPC), AI infrastructure or related technical fields.
    • Prior experience in a hyperscale data center or similar large‑scale IT environment is preferred.
    • Direct experience working with AI hardware, such as NVIDIA H100, AMD MI300, NVIDIA A100, or similar GPU‑based accelerator systems is a plus.
  • Technical

    Skills:
    • Proficient in server hardware installation and troubleshooting (e.g., Dell, HPE, Cisco).
    • Experience with high‑performance storage systems (e.g., NVMe, SSD) and network infrastructure optimized for AI workloads.
    • Experience with networking equipment (routers, switches, firewalls).
    • Understanding of high‑throughput networking (10/25/40/100

      GbE), Infini Band, and RDMA for data center communication.
    • Familiarity with operating systems, including Linux, Windows Server, and virtualization technologies (VMware, Hyper‑V).
    • Understanding of data center cooling, power distribution, and backup systems.
    • Experience with cable management and physical infrastructure best practices.
  • Problem‑Solving:
    • Strong analytical and troubleshooting skills to quickly resolve technical issues.
    • Ability to diagnose issues across multiple system layers, from hardware to network to application.
  • Certifications (preferred):
    • CompTIA A+, Network+, or similar certifications.
    • Cisco CCNA or equivalent.
    • Data Center Certified Associate (DCCA) or similar certifications.
  • Soft Skills:
    • Strong communication and teamwork skills.
    • Ability to work in a fast‑paced, high‑pressure environment.
    • Attention to detail, organizational skills, and ability to follow detailed processes.
  • Physical Requirements:
    • Ability to lift heavy equipment (up to 75 lbs) and work in physically demanding environments.
    • Ability to work in environments with varying temperatures, noise, and other physical conditions typical of a data center to include standing/walking long hours and working on ladders.
    • Willing to work night and day shift along with weekends.
    • Willing to work at multiple locations in the Metro PHX area.
    • Must have reliable transportation.
Responsibilities
  • Hardware Installation & Maintenance:
    Install, configure, and maintain servers, storage devices, network equipment, and other hardware components in the data center. Perform regular hardware inspections, upgrades, and replacements.
  • Troubleshooting & Issue Resolution:
    Quickly identify and resolve hardware and network issues, ensuring minimal downtime. Troubleshoot a variety of systems including server infrastructure, networking equipment, and power distribution units (PDUs).
  • Network Support:
    Assist in maintaining and troubleshooting network connections, switches, and firewalls to ensure optimal data flow.
  • Collaboration & Communication:
    Work closely with other teams (Network Engineers, Systems Engineers, and Operations Managers) to coordinate installations, upgrades, and problem resolution. Communicate with external vendors and service providers as needed.
  • Safety & Compliance:
    Follow strict safety protocols and ensure compliance with industry standards, environmental guidelines, and company policies.
